On 11/24/2015 05:38 AM, Lan Tianyu wrote:
> This patchset is to propose a solution of adding live migration
> support for SRIOV NIC.
>
> During migration, Qemu needs to let VF driver in the VM to know
> migration start and end. Qemu adds faked PCI migration capability
> to help to sync status between two sides during migration.
>
> Qemu triggers VF's mailbox irq via sending MSIX msg when migration
> status is changed. VF driver tells Qemu its mailbox vector index
> via the new PCI capability. In some cases(NIC is suspended or closed),
> VF mailbox irq is freed and VF driver can disable irq injecting via
> new capability.
>
> VF driver will put down nic before migration and put up again on
> the target machine.
>

I'm still not a fan of this approach. I really feel like this is
something that should be resolved by extending the existing PCI hot-plug
rather than trying to instrument this per driver. Then you will get the
goodness for multiple drivers and multiple OSes instead of just one. An
added advantage to dealing with this in the PCI hot-plug environment
would be that you could then still do a hot-plug even if the guest
didn't load a driver for the VF since you would be working with the PCI
slot instead of the device itself.
